The Wisconsin Republicans Have an '08 Straw Poll

So the latest snapshot of the fluid race for the Republican presidential nomination in 2008 comes from Wisconsin, where the state Republican convention conducted a straw poll last weekend. The outcome?

US Senator George Allen - 61 votes, former NYC Mayor Rudy Giuliani - 60, former US House Speaker Newt Gingrich - 53, Secretary of State Condi Rice - 50, Governor Mitt Romney - 40, US Senator John McCain - 37, US Senator Sam Brownback - 11, US Senate Majority Leader Bill Frist and Congressman Tom Tancredo tied with 8 each, Governor George Pataki - 4, Governor Mike Huckabee - 2, US Senator Chuck Hagel - 1.

Yep, John McCain came in 6th place, while Newt Gingrich came in 3rd. This is just a "beauty contest" of course, but it gives us some sense of how party activists see this race shaping up in that section of the country.
